Everyone has a beautiful voice.

Updated: Aug 18, 2020

I can't tell you the number of times I have heard the phrase 'I can't sing' or 'I don't have a natural voice'. We live in a world where we believe that the ability to sing is something we are born with - that there is a biological imprint for vocal talent. What's interesting is that we only think this way about the voice. No one in the world ever expected to hit a perfect serve the first time they picked up a tennis racket, or play Rachmaninoff Piano Concerto No 3 flawlessly having never seen it before, but we expect to be able to sing without practice - "you either have it or you don't" mentality.


Now, don't get me wrong, there are people who are born with incredible voices, but that doesn't mean that they necessarily know how to use it. If you sit me down in front of a Steinway I will play you a mean chopsticks, but thats about it. It doesn't matter how amazing the piano is, without the years of training it takes to perfect such a complicated instrument, will never rise to its full potential. Similarly, if we put a virtuoso pianist in front of a pub piano, they will play that busted old Joanna beautifully. Why can't it be the same with the voice? Well, it can be! The world is full of incredible artists who don't have what we perceive as beautiful voices, but boy can they sing!


So often, innate ability is confused with time. If you grew up in a household where you heard singing every day, were praised for being loud, and were surrounded by instruments, there is a higher chance you are going to be able to carry a tune or two.


It's about passion, drive, love, and... time.


So whether you think you have a Steinway or a pub piano.


Practise - Sing! Sing in the shower, on your way to work, at home, at work.


Learn - Take lessons, read books, go to masterclasses.


Discover - Go to concerts, the theatre, listen to new bands and people you admire.


Most importantly, embrace your voice for all its glorious eccentricities!


You are beautiful, and so is your voice!
